深入解析:从输入 URL 到页面呈现的完整全过程
想要彻底搞清楚浏览器在按下 Enter 键后经历了什么,这份 GitHub 上的深度指南提供了从底层网络到前端渲染的完整链路分析,是攻克该经典面试题的优质学习资源。
核心知识点覆盖
该项目将复杂的网络请求过程拆解为多个关键阶段,引导读者循序渐进地理解 Web 工作原理:
- 地址解析与 DNS 查询: 域名如何转换为服务器 IP 地址。
- 网络传输协议: TCP 握手、HTTP/HTTPS 协议的交互机制。
- 浏览器渲染引擎: 从 HTML 解析、DOM 树构建到最终页面的绘制过程。
资源获取
该指南支持多语言版本(含中、英、日、韩等),你可以根据习惯选择对应的仓库阅读:
- 中文版: GitHub 仓库地址
- 英文版: GitHub 仓库地址
适用场景
如果你正处于前端 / 后端面试准备阶段,或者希望系统性地梳理计算机网络与浏览器内核知识,这份文档能够帮你将碎片化的知识点串联成完整的技术链路。
正文完
